What Is a No-Buy Challenge and Why Is It Trending?
A no-buy obstacle is specifically what it seems like: an individual commitment to stop buying non-essential items for a specific period of time. This can be as brief as a weekend break or as enthusiastic as an entire year. Participants often limit acquisitions to fundamentals like groceries, rental fee, and transportation, while saying no to takeout, online shopping, brand-new clothing, and impulse buys.
What makes the no-buy obstacle specifically appropriate in 2025 is its countercultural energy. After years of rising cost of living, supply chain problems, and shifting economic self-confidence, consumers are reviewing what's genuinely worth their money. Individuals are not only aiming to save they're looking to reclaim control.

The Psychological Shift That Happens When You Pause Spending
One of the most unforeseen incentives of a no-buy challenge is how it reshapes your connection with cash. When you step off the intake treadmill, you begin to notice the difference between emotional spending and intentional investing. You may find that purchasing a new sweatshirt doesn't really fix a difficult week-- or that your Saturday coffee habit has been even more concerning regular than satisfaction.
This frame of mind shift isn't just thoughtful-- it straight influences your funds. Little leaks in your budget become visible. Idle subscriptions obtain terminated. Daily practices become selections, not defaults. It's in these silent moments of reflection that the actual financial savings begin to add up.

What to Expect Month by Month
In the first month, interest is high. You'll most likely feel pleased, perhaps even unstoppable. You track your savings. You observe less packages at your door. However by month 2 or 3, the initial energy might discolor. That's when structure comes to be essential.
This is the moment to revisit your goals, readjust your limits, and also journal your thoughts. Assess what has actually really felt hardest and what has stunned you. With time, your investing sets off come to be clearer. You discover just how to navigate them not simply throughout the challenge, but for the remainder of your life.
